The custom varsity was designed in celebration of sisterhood and service! This jacket features:

  • Cream vegan leather sleeves with cream wool body

  • Green and cream striped Trim

  • Flat embroidered AKA on right breast

  • “100 Years of GHOE” embroidered in pink on right wrist

  • Custom Colored A&T emblem on left sleeve

  • Chenille ivy with embroidered pearls middle of left sleeve

  • Chenille 1932 with embroidered outline on bottom left sleeve

  • Number customization on left sleeve

  • Custom business is business design on back.
